Yttria-Stabilized Zirconia of Balanced Acid-Base Pair for Selective Dehydration of 4-Methyl-2-pentanol to 4-Methyl-1-pentene
The selective transformation of secondary alcohols to alpha-olefins is a challenging task in heterogeneous catalysis, as is the case of 4-methyl-2-pentanol (4M2Pol) conversion to 4-methyl-1-pentene (4M1P).
